Transaction 5305fe264065b990cc824b8a2860d07f1af75d4c24c4c10e0e184fc51f037513
1 Input
1 Output
-
5305fe264065b990cc824b8a2860d07f1af75d4c24c4c10e0e184fc51f037513:0
- value
- 108807
- script pubkey
- OP_0 OP_PUSHBYTES_20 7a6f9680be087424f28a283e7c1e5f2b012e0916
- address
- bc1q0fhedq97pp6zfu529ql8c8jl9vqjuzgkf2hkwa